html滚动条,HTML滚动条最简单设置

2025-03-07 06:46:11 59 0

HTML滚动条简介

在网页设计中,滚动条是提升用户体验的重要元素。它允许用户在内容超出视窗时进行滚动查看。小编将详细介绍HTML滚动条的最简单设置方法,包括滚动条的宽度和颜色等设置。

1.使用draggale属性

在HTML中,可以通过设置draggale="true"属性来指定页面中的元素是否可以被拖拽。以下是一个简单的示例:

Title

width:200x

height:200x

ackground-color:green

draggale:true

在这个例子中,.ox1元素可以被拖拽。

2.使用``标签

标签是HTML中用于创建滚动文本的一个简单方法。以下是标签的一些常用属性:

-direction:指定滚动方向,可以是left、right、u或down。

ehavior:指定滚动方式,可以是scroll、slide或alternate。

width:设置滚动区域的宽度。

这是一个滚动文本

这个例子中,文本将从右向左滚动,每次滚动都会移动整个文本宽度。

3.使用CSS自定义滚动条

CSS提供了丰富的样式设置,可以自定义滚动条的外观。以下是一些常用的CSS属性:

-scrollar-width:设置滚动条的宽度,可以是thin或none。scrollar-color:设置滚动条的颜色。

width:200x

height:200x

ackground-color:green

overflow-y:auto

ox1::-wekit-scrollar{

width:10x

ox1::-wekit-scrollar-track{

ackground:#f0f0f0

ox1::-wekit-scrollar-thum{

ackground:#999999

在这个例子中,.ox1元素的滚动条被设置为宽度为10x,颜色为灰色,滚动条轨道颜色为淡灰色。

4.使用JavaScrit实现复杂滚动效果

除了简单的滚动效果,还可以使用JavaScrit来实现更复杂的滚动效果,如视差滚动。以下是一个简单的视差滚动示例:

arallax{

height:500x

ackground:url('ackground.jg')no-reeatcentercenterfixed

ackground-size:cover

window.addEventListener('scroll',function(){

varscrollosition=window.ageYOffset||document.documentElement.scrollTo

vararallax=document.querySelector('.arallax')

arallax.style.ackgroundositionY=scrollosition*0.5+'x'

在这个例子中,背景图片会随着页面的滚动而移动,创造出视差效果。

通过以上方法,您可以轻松地在HTML中设置和自定义滚动条。无论是简单的文本滚动还是复杂的视差效果,都可以根据需要灵活运用。

收藏
分享
海报
0 条评论
4
请文明发言哦~